You can use the following commands in-game as OP to ban/unban players on your Minecraft Server. Commands can be run in the multicraft console too, make sure to remove the / when running commands via ths console. Ban players /ban username reason This bans a player by their username, stopping them being able to connect, adding a reason is optional.

How do I Ban a player on a Minecraft server?
To use the /ban command, you must be an operator of the Minecraft server. The /ban command is used to add a player to the server’s blacklist (or ban list). This will ban that player from connecting to the Minecraft server. Use the /pardon command to allow the player to connect to the server again.
